Find out more »Thomas Mountain
Trip Description: Rating: Easy Route: We will explore the trails on Thomas Mountain. The trails are hard-packed dirt trails that wind up to the summit at 6,825 feet. It is a fun and fairly easy dirt trail that winds through oaks and pinyons to grassy meadows, then tall pines and cedars with fir trees at the highest levels. There are primitive campgrounds at the top for those that want to camp. Saturday we will enter Rouse Hill Truck Trail at…

Joshua Tree
Trip Description: Rating: Easy Route: We will explore trails in Joshua Tree National Park. Saturday morning, we will leave from the Deer Springs Park and Ride for a 3 hour drive to the trailhead on the southwest side of the park (not an official park entrance). Our first trail is Berdoo Canyon (easy with optional moderate spurs for those who want more challenge). Then we take the Pleasant Valley/Squaw Tank trail to the Geology Tour trail.
